Audius (AUDIO) is a decentralized music streaming protocol initially built on POA network, but now living on Solana. Audius aims to align the interests of artists, fans, and node operators through its platform powered by its native AUDIO token. Artists can upload music, stored and distributed by content, that fans can listen to for free.

Built on Sui, it allows for the handling of both on-chain and off-chain data using Move-based smart contracts. Developed by Mysten Labs, Walrus is the first network that permits storage of any data size on-chain at scale. This capability enhances how Web3 projects use their data, supporting the development of diverse on-chain businesses.
